Select furnishings that are essential and also proportional to the size of the room. Unless the bedroom is huge avoid purchasing over-scaled furniture. For example, always invest in low-headboards instead of poster beds if the room has low ceilings. Take into consideration the dimensions of the nightstands, armoires, chest and seating you might need. Larger furniture piece in a small room will make the from feel overcrowded. On the other hand, small scaled size furniture pieces would disappear in a large room. When purchasing bedroom furnishings, take the dimensions of the room into consideration and also that of the furnishing to ensure that the various pieces complement each other as well as the space.

Choose the right color palette for the room. It is best to stay aware from vibrant color palette for bedrooms. When selecting paint colors, select restful color plate in shades that are soothing and monochromatic. Soft greens, blues, and lavender create a subdue effect which is very calming to the soul. Brown and amber on the other hand create a cozy warm effect. To add another point of interest to a bedroom, paint the ceiling in a slightly lighter shade of the wall color. Adding color to a ceiling visually lowers the ceiling and it makes the room feel more intimate, cozy and comfortable.
Similar to any other room, create layers of lighting in the bedroom. Use a ceiling mounted fixture as your ambient lighting. This will illuminate the entire room. If you enjoy reading in bed, a task light, such as a table lamp would provide you just the right amount of light for reading. Lastly, ambient lighting such as wallsconce would add a dramatic impact to the room. Use dimmers to control the dramatic lighting effect in the bedroom.
Select luxurious tactile bedding. Invest in natural fiber linen with high thread count, plush pillows, cozy covers and a tactile throw. For a hotel boutique look invest in hotel-level linens and bed set available for sale in selected hotels like the Marriot.
Dress up the window with beautiful drapery treatment that would add color, texture, pattern and softness into the room. Use drapery opaque fabric that can block out natural light or even better use black out lining in custom draperies to block the suns glare.
